What is 16 Gauge Welded Wire?


Wire gauge measures the thickness of the wire, represented in numbers where a lower number indicates a thicker wire. The 16 gauge wire is approximately 0.0625 inches in diameter, making it thicker than many other gauges like 18 or 20, which are commonly used in various applications. This added thickness provides enhanced strength and rigidity, making 16 gauge welded wire a reliable option for construction and reinforcement purposes.

Common Applications


1. Fencing One of the most common uses for welded wire is fencing, as it provides security while allowing visibility. 1% 202% 16 gauge welded wire is perfect for keeping pets in or wildlife out in residential yards, farms, or larger agricultural settings.


2. Reinforcement in Construction In reinforced concrete applications, this wire can be utilized to provide additional support for slabs, walls, and other structures where tensile strength is crucial.


3. Storage Solutions Welded wire panels are often used in industrial shelving and storage systems. The strength of 16 gauge offers the ability to hold heavy loads while ensuring safety and accessibility.


4. Horticulture and Gardening Gardeners frequently use welded wire to create trellises, cages for plants, and even protective enclosures against animals, benefiting from its strength and durability.


5. Safety Barriers In many industrial applications, welded wire is used to create barriers that ensure safety protocols are followed, preventing unauthorized access to hazardous areas.
